Chris Smalls, Founding President of the Amazon Labor Union (ALU), joined the America’s Work Force Union Podcast and discussed how running an independent campaign proved critical to the ALU’s success in forming the first Amazon labor union in the U.S.

Smalls was one of the three high profile guests for AWF’s Special Labor Day Episode.

He maintained the ALU’s independent approach was best for its members because it celebrated their identity. Many people, especially the young, gravitated to the Union’s style and the way it organized, he said. The ALU is the face of today’s young generation and its independent identity inspires many young workers, he added.

Smalls shared his experience of testifying before Congress and being invited to the White House, but stressed he prefers grassroots organizing as a means of strengthening the labor movement and empowering workers.
